Eiffage consolidates its presence in Spain by acquiring energy services companies CVS, M3i Controls and Inmotechnia
Eiffage, through its subsidiary Eiffage Énergie Systèmes, pursues its strategy of expansion in Europe, strengthening its geographical coverage and expertise in the energy services space. The Group thus completed three new acquisitions in Spain over the summer.
The first acquisition is Spanish company CVS specialised in refrigeration solutions for industry and the commercial sector, as well as in fire detection and protection systems. CVS covers the entire value chain, from engineering, design and assembly through to installation and maintenance. Founded in 2020, the company has over 300 employees and benefits from a national coverage through its 11 sites spread over the territory . In 2024, it generated revenue of €60 million.
In parallel, Eiffage Énergie Systèmes has acquired two companies in order to achieve national coverage in the building control and centralised management systems:
-
M3i Controls, a Catalan company specialised in control and automation systems for commercial buildings, which has a workforce of 26 employees and generated a revenue of €3 million in 2024.
-
Inmotechnia, a company with expertise in smart Building Energy Management Systems (BEMS), which operates throughout the country with a workforce of 64 employees and generated a revenue of €10 million in 2024.
Spain is a key European country for Eiffage Énergie Systèmes, which had more than 5,000 employees there in 2024, generating €1.1 billion in revenue.
